About

James David Sparks is a business attorney with 15 years of legal experience, practicing at Sparks Law Group, PLLC in Scottsdale, AZ. He earned a degree from Arizona State University B.S. in 2005 and a J.D. from Phoenix School of Law in 2010. He has been admitted to the Arizona Bar since 2010. His practice encompasses business and personal injury, allowing him to serve clients across a range of legal needs. Mr. Sparks offers contingency fee arrangements, making legal representation more accessible to those in need. He ma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
